Electronic structure for the two-band Hubbard model of the ladder alpha -NaV2O5 compound
Апстракт
An effective Hubbard model for one-particle d-like states and two-particle singlet states is derived in order to describe the low-energy electronic spectrum in ladder alpha-NaV2O5 compound. The energy shifts and the renormalized hopping parameters for the considered electronic states are calculated on the basis of the projection technique for the two-time matrix Greens function in terms of Hubbard operators.
